Ink is an Ethereum Layer-2 blockchain built by Kraken and part of the Optimism Superchain. Designed for DeFi, Ink offers cost effective, fast, and composable infrastructure that makes it easier for developers and users to access new financial opportunities onchain. Its ecosystem already includes a growing set of DEXs, perpetuals protocols, and other innovative DeFi apps.

Users will be able to access USDC on Ink via digital asset exchanges and ecosystem apps. Qualified businesses can also access USDC on Ink from a Circle Mint account.4 Regardless of your choice, it’s easy to get started.

1

Open a Circle Mint account

Submit your business information and we’ll get the account opening process started.

2

Create a deposit

Once approved, you can deposit funds into your Circle Mint account via wire transfer. Funds will settle seamlessly in USDC.

3

Choose USDC on Ink

You can use a Circle Mint account to directly convert fiat to USDC on Ink, and easily convert back to fiat the same way. Circle Mint also enables you to swap USDC across supported blockchains without needing a third-party bridge. USDC on Ink is redeemable 1:1 for US dollars.3
